Let me tell you why these little squares of tech magic have become my household's MVP. After testing them in everything from cat shelters to pool pumps, here's the real deal.
The Good Stuff:
• Animal rescue hero: I use these in an outdoor cat shelter 150ft away. Controlling heat lamps via phone during snowstorms? Lifesaver (literally). The scheduled on/off feature means no more 3AM treks to check on strays.
• Surprisingly rugged: Been running a 1.5HP pool pump through one for 3 years outdoors (with weather cover). Still going strong despite humidity and temperature swings.
• Alexa/Google Assistant BFFs:"Alexa, turn on kitty heat" works instantly. Voice commands feel magical when your hands are full with pet food bowls.
The Quirks:
• App overload: The Govee Home app has EVERY option imaginable. Great for techies, overwhelming if you just want simple lamp scheduling.
• No sunrise mode: My gecko-keeping friend misses gradual light transitions. You'll need to manually program multiple steps for simulated dawn/dusk.
Pro Tips:
- Use the physical button when phones are dead - it's saved me during power outages. - Stack two plugs vertically in tight outlets (unlike bulkier competitors). - Create "holiday lights" groups that you can modify seasonally without reconfiguring.
The Verdict:
From keeping abandoned cats warm to automating my Christmas lights, these $25 plugs deliver pro-level performance. Just be ready for a mildly confusing app - once set up though, they're rock-solid reliable. Two thumbs up from this animal rescuer!
